Tom Brady is the walking definition of the cliché “patience is a virtue." A product of the University of Michigan, Brady had to endure watching quarterbacks with inferior talent receive playing time ahead of him. Frustrated and disillusioned with his chances to play, he considered transferring back to his home state of California to play for Cal. Fate had other plans, as a series of events and the graduation of other athletes finally allowed the talented Brady to earn the starting position. He subsequently led the Wolverines to a Big-Ten Conference title and wins in both the Citrus Bowl and the Orange Bowl.
Despite his collegiate success, pro teams shied away from Brady in the 2000 NFL Draft. He was eventually picked in the sixth round with the 199th overall pick. He saw only a few snaps during his rookie year, but in 2001 following an injury to Drew Bledsoe, Brady assumed the helm and never looked back.
Since then, he has assembled a résumé placing him among the all-time greats of the game. A three-time Super Bowl Champion, two-time Super Bowl MVP, six-time Pro Bowl choice, named the Sportsmen of the Year three times, a member of the 2000's All-Decade Team, a 21-game winning streak and the NFL record holder for most consecutive wins in postseason at 10 breaking Bart Starr's, once thought, unbreakable record.
Playing in a major market like Boston and being a Wolverine alumni means Brady has tons of fans and collectors. All of his rookie cards debuted in the year 2000. Most notable is his card #144 from 2000 Playoff Contenders. It is his only autographed rookie card and commands big dollars on the secondary market.
Despite the number of other cards produced during his rookie campaign, high-grade samples continue to increase in value. Being a three-time Super Bowl Champion in New England means your autographed material is always in demand. Single-signed and team signed balls from the championship years carry a premium.
